This work investigates the fundamental principles of osteopathic medicine and the concept of the primary respiratory mechanism as defined by the author. Rollin E. Becker, a prominent practitioner and educator in the field of osteopathy, draws upon decades of clinical experience to articulate his philosophy of health and healing. The text presents a framework for understanding the subtle, rhythmic motions of the human body and how these motions relate to overall physiological function and structural integrity.
